In a recent discussion, the developers of Peak shared insights into their unique pricing strategy. The popular co-op mountain-climbing game was initially launched in June 2025 with a promotional price of $5 before settling at a standard price point of $8. This deliberate choice is not arbitrary but rests on a foundation of psychological principles and developer intuition, as co-creator Nick Kaman explained.
Understanding the Pricing Psychology Behind Peak
In an interview with Game File, Kaman introduced a light-hearted yet insightful theory regarding consumer price perception.“We often joked about the actual value of a game. How do players interpret spending five dollars? To them, it’s just five bucks. But when it comes to six dollars, it also feels like five bucks, ” he elaborated.
Kaman proposed a conceptual framework featuring various psychological thresholds in pricing. For example, he explained that prices set at $4, $6, and even $8 can evoke similar responses to a $5 price tag. However, once the price climbs to $10, it transforms into a psychologically significant barrier for many consumers.

He further illustrated his points with examples, saying, “These tiers are interesting: you see that twelve bucks feels like ten bucks, but once you reach thirteen bucks, it starts to feel like fifteen bucks. We discovered that eight bucks resonates as five bucks without crossing into ten bucks territory. Even $7.99 feels like five bucks, right?”
The primary objective of Kaman and his team was to determine the ideal price that minimizes perceived risk for players, while still ensuring sufficient revenue to fund ongoing game updates and future projects. He noted, “We found that eight bucks compared to five bucks represented the most favorable pricing differential we could achieve; thus, it became our optimal price point.”
This well-thought-out pricing strategy has proven effective, as Peak has emerged as one of 2025’s standout indie successes, selling millions of copies and cultivating a vibrant community engaged in its whimsical co-op adventures.
